Time is Your Friend

Patience finding love seems rough to begin
Impatience is accepted, yet leads to no win
Respect for the person speaks volumes to them
I desire to be a member, of a few good men

What time is enough, too little or much
Ask of friends opine, encouraging words touch
Lending their thought, promoting a pursuit
Many with spouse, and happy cannot dispute

Men ask “for what am I waiting”
Women may adore, greater time for dating
Time my best friend, I think ladies are right
Taking time and then happiness stays in sight

Protecting your heart from a future brake
Past experience show how hearts can ache
Defending feelings and still showing you care
The desire is to kiss her, speak, let truth lay bare

Six weeks of seeing the other a start
A few more reasonable before showing my heart
The rest of my life to find love with a friend
Time will build bonds and problem will see mend

The more time accrued of building this bond
Prior to telling when she must respond
I care for her much, but do not claim to love yet
Reasonable as we both have love misspent

Past relations have taught both to see
Joy comes with a partner if they set you free
From worry of feelings, intensions and worry
They love you deeply, desire you most happy

Their feelings of love will allow them to abstain
From daily tempts, whole heart can refrain
Encouraged by wrong, never give into
A life faithful, they want only for you

If only to be married, truly love one
Time is a friend, there is more to this sum
Love built with time, growing strength slow
I hope God blesses the two seen below
